ArcGIS Diagrammer 9.2 Beta

Richie Carmichael released ArcGIS Diagrammer 9.2 (beta) and it is very impressive. I’ve used Geodatabase Diagrammer in the past with Visio to create such graphics, but this new ArcGIS Diagrammer will simplify the process. ArcGIS Diagrammer is a visual editor for ESRI’s Xml Workspace Document that is created out of ArcCatalog. You can graphically manipulate the geodatabase schema in a GUI application that is best described as a cross between Visual Studio 2005 and Visio. I tried to load up the whole schema for SDSFIE 2.5, but alas I didn’t have enough memory (or patience) on my laptop to let it complete. Simple geodatabases though are a breeze to edit and analyze. Anyone who manages data with the ESRI Geodatabase will want to check this tool out.

Click for large image

This entry was posted in ArcGIS Desktop, ArcSDE, ESRI. Bookmark the permalink. Both comments and trackbacks are currently closed.

17 Comments

  1. Posted July 23, 2007 at 4:07 pm | Permalink

    Wow… SDSFIE won’t load?? I remember watching it take over 8 hours to load SDSFIE into a Personal Geodatabase.. So to display it graphically isn’t a huge surprise. But the tool sounds totally cool… will check that out!!

  2. Brian Johnson
    Posted July 24, 2007 at 8:00 am | Permalink

    James -

    I’ve wanted to diagram the SDSFIE schema for a long time, since the ‘rational rose’ PDF documents that come with the release are such a waste of digital paper….and this tool seemed to warrant an attempt.

    I downloaded the Diagrammer – then saw I needed an XML workspace file to import. Going into ArcCatalog, figuring I would create this file from an SDSFIE geodatabase – I found out I am out of luck since XML workspace export is not available at the ArcView license level. Once again – ESRI makes my life a search for a workaround….maybe someday I can get the extra $K to finally get an ArcEditor or ArcInfo license. Hmmm…what other software can I give up to free the budget? Nothing….

    So – I went to http://www.sdefie.org looking for a XML file or maybe an export tool…and found the Geobatabase XML Constructor, thinking that might help – but it doesn’t work and crashes on my system. Whew…like I’ve got more time today to try and get the Diagrammer tool to work…

    Do you know of a source to download an XML Workspace file for SDSFIE, either v2.5 or v2.6?

  3. Brian Johnson
    Posted July 24, 2007 at 8:24 am | Permalink

    FYI…my problem with the Geodatabase XML Constructor was that I only had v2.5 installed. After installing v2.6 , it worked…but it doesn’t create a usable XML workspace file, but probably an XML file to use in an SDSFIE compliance checker.

  4. Posted July 24, 2007 at 8:25 am | Permalink

    Brian, I’ll throw up the 2.5 workspace xml on my server. Its 84 megs uncompressed so I’ve zipped it up.

    SDSFIE 2.5 XML Workspace – 8 MB Download

  5. JC
    Posted July 24, 2007 at 8:48 am | Permalink

    ArcCatalog simply crashes when I try to do the XML export. I love this software!!!

  6. Brian Johnson
    Posted July 24, 2007 at 9:05 am | Permalink

    Thanks James!

    I didn’t realize the size of the whole SDSFIE model. Maybe I’ll trying loading it up one night…

  7. Posted July 24, 2007 at 3:45 pm | Permalink

    It works great !

    On a side note: Google bought their own aerial cameras acquiring ImageAmerica… http://www.image-america.com/

  8. Posted July 30, 2007 at 4:14 pm | Permalink

    Update from Richie:

    “Good news. I have got the load time for the SDSFIE25 data model down to 30 seconds on my computer. There issue was not with the diagram but with the catalog window. The catalog window was doing some unnecessary computation. I will release a new version tonight after some more testing and documentation.”
  9. Jason Delwin Rose
    Posted October 16, 2007 at 11:34 am | Permalink

    Does anyone know if it is possible to set the xy resolution for your feature classes with the GDB diagrammer 9.2 beta?. I see the ability to edit the tolerance but alas not the resolution. Any help would be awesome. Thanks.

  10. Posted October 16, 2007 at 9:27 pm | Permalink

    Hi Jason,

    ArcCatalog’s “XY resolution” for a feature class is equivalent to the inverse of ArcGIS Diagrammer’s “XY scale”.

    That is: XYResolution = 1 / XYScale, or 1 / XYResolution = XYScale

    Here is a recent whitepaper that explains the geodatabase coordinate management in 9.2 and pre-9.2. http://support.esri.com/index.cfm?fa=knowledgebase.whitepapers.viewPaper&PID=43&MetaID=1301

    Hope this helps.

    Regards, Richie

  11. Rubens_Jr
    Posted July 3, 2008 at 7:05 am | Permalink

    Installed the ArcGis Diagrammer and went to change language of the reports for Portuguese, but noted that the project there was an “FILE_GEODATABASE_EXCHANGE.xsd.”. Do you could send my email? rjunior@img.com.br

  12. Posted July 7, 2008 at 11:57 am | Permalink

    Hi Rubens,

    The file referenced as “file_geodatabase_exchange.xsd” in the ArcGIS Diagrammer source code is equivalent to the following file in ArcGIS Desktop 9.3: C:\program files\arcgis\xmlschema\gdbexchange.xsd

    I mistakening omitted this file from the ArcGIS Diagrammer source code, sorry. This will be included in future versions.

    To make a Portuguese data and/or schema reports, edit the following files and then recompile ArcGIS Diagrammer. ESRI.ArcGIS.Diagrammer\xml\file_data_report.xslt, and/or ESRI.ArcGIS.Diagrammer\xml\file_schema_report.xslt

    For future assistance with ArcGIS Diagrammer, may I suggest you post questions to the ESRI data model forum: http://forums.esri.com/forums.asp?c=141

    Kind Regards, Richie

  13. Rubens_Jr
    Posted July 7, 2008 at 12:47 pm | Permalink

    Hi Richie,

    Thanks, I will insert the file in project and I will send the file file_schema_report.xslt in portuguese for you later.

    Rubens_Jr

  14. fhb
    Posted September 10, 2008 at 7:47 pm | Permalink

    hello,i use the diagrammer to design a GDB.but there is a error :Field type’esrifieldtypeGlodblId’ is unsupported! i want to know why? thanks for your answering!

  15. Posted September 10, 2008 at 9:07 pm | Permalink

    Hi fhb,

    Please post questions to the following forum. http://forums.esri.com/forums.asp?c=141

    Richie

  16. fhb
    Posted September 11, 2008 at 6:27 am | Permalink

    Thanks ! I have Posted the question on the forum!

  17. FHB
    Posted November 15, 2008 at 6:37 am | Permalink

    an question: the title is Arcgis Diagrammer:I cant open Geometrical Network’s Properties in arccatalog! i have posted it on the esri forum. and an attachment is uploaded! Thans for your answings!

One Trackback

  1. By ESRI and ERM Diagram - Ahead of the curve on July 30, 2007 at 1:05 pm

    [...] You can read further at the following links:http://www.spatiallyadjusted.com/2007/07/23/arcgis-diagrammer-92-beta/ [...]

  • License

  • Disclaimer

    The information in this weblog is provided "AS IS" with no warranties, and confers no rights.

    This weblog does not represent the thoughts, intentions, plans or strategies of my employer. It is solely my opinion and probably incorrect.

  • Meta